Michael Baker International is a long-established engineering and consulting firm that delivers planning, design, construction, and program management services across infrastructure sectors. With more than eight decades of experience and nearly 100 offices nationwide, the firm partners with clients on complex public and private projects that improve communities and the built environment.

Key Responsibilities:
• Communicate regularly with project managers across multiple offices to coordinate billing activities.
• Prepare, review, and process high-volume, complex invoices with minimal supervision.
• Ensure invoices meet client-specific requirements and comply with company policy.
• Submit invoices through client invoicing portals and maintain accurate submission records.
• Manage multiple billing assignments, prioritizing tasks to meet shifting deadlines.
• Analyze and verify cost and time data to confirm billing accuracy.
• Build and maintain billing schedules aligned with contract terms.
• Reconcile accounts, investigate discrepancies, and resolve issues promptly.
• Provide documentation and support for internal and external audits.
• Organize and retain billing files and related communications for reference and compliance.
